Output 250a257fccc00dcec6b859f129636ee121ca0a73e9f766e78082f872a158d041:2

value
17700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449b9c9556e7d6e3cddea3b1acfac129c6d17c59 OP_EQUAL
address
ME9vbZYWTM2VHLxHKY1x6DxpmyddFH89Y6
transaction
250a257fccc00dcec6b859f129636ee121ca0a73e9f766e78082f872a158d041
spent
true